AN 3132 - Women’s Lives in Cross-Cultural Perspective

(4)
The lives of women in a variety of tribal and peasant societies, noting how beliefs, rituals and taboos shape the stages of the female life course and how culture influences women’s reproductive and economic roles. Identical with (WGS 337 or WGS 3815 ). (Formerly AN 337)
Prerequisite(s): (AN 102 or AN 1111 ) or (WGS 200 or WGS 1000 )
